回答:隨著項(xiàng)目的發(fā)展,技術(shù)架構(gòu)方案也是會(huì)慢慢演變的。比如說(shuō)淘寶最早期是由單純的PHP開(kāi)發(fā)的站點(diǎn),到現(xiàn)在單一架構(gòu)模式已滿足不了其發(fā)展需要,于是乎演變成了異構(gòu)模式(即:多種技術(shù)的混合架構(gòu)模式)?,F(xiàn)在市面上的開(kāi)發(fā)語(yǔ)言眾多,同一個(gè)產(chǎn)品線的多個(gè)子項(xiàng)目采用不同的編程語(yǔ)言開(kāi)發(fā)也是很常見(jiàn)的。但對(duì)于不同語(yǔ)言開(kāi)發(fā)的站點(diǎn)默認(rèn)情況下Session是無(wú)法共用的,那么在異構(gòu)模式下如何實(shí)現(xiàn)Session互通呢?下面給大家具體分析一下...
回答:首先來(lái)說(shuō),Session存儲(chǔ)于服務(wù)器端,由于服務(wù)器上有很多Session,如果我們要操作某個(gè)Session就需要一個(gè)標(biāo)識(shí)key,在Session機(jī)制中,這個(gè)標(biāo)識(shí)Key就是SessionID。其實(shí)這很好理解,舉個(gè)例子:你把服務(wù)器當(dāng)成一個(gè)教室,每個(gè)Session就是一個(gè)學(xué)生,如果你要找到某個(gè)學(xué)生,就需要知道這個(gè)學(xué)生的姓名。請(qǐng)注意,不同WEB容器生成的SessionID名稱是不同的,比如說(shuō)PHP的Ses...
回答:我們知道,Session和Cookie配合起來(lái)使用可用來(lái)實(shí)現(xiàn)會(huì)話跟蹤與控制。在一些場(chǎng)景下可能需要做單IP限制登錄,很多開(kāi)發(fā)者可能就會(huì)想到用Session會(huì)話來(lái)實(shí)現(xiàn),但是不能單獨(dú)靠Session來(lái)實(shí)現(xiàn)單IP限制登錄。第一步:?jiǎn)蜪P登錄限制需要基于會(huì)話控制這個(gè)很好理解,既然有登錄,那就離不開(kāi)會(huì)話控制技術(shù)(Cookie+Session),當(dāng)用戶成功登錄后,我們需要獲取到用戶的IP,同時(shí)標(biāo)記會(huì)話狀態(tài),這樣...
...是 true) */ rolling: true, /** 是否每次響應(yīng)時(shí)刷新Session的有效期。(默認(rèn)是 false) */ renew: false, /** 是否在Session快過(guò)期時(shí)刷新Session的有效期。(默認(rèn)是 false) */ }; 我們需要關(guān)注這幾個(gè)配置: renew rolling 這兩個(gè)都可以在用戶訪問(wèn)的過(guò)...
...ession對(duì)象,從而獲取用戶的狀態(tài)信息 session的生命周期(有效期)? cookie生命周期: 如果cookie不設(shè)定時(shí)間的話就表視它的生命周期為瀏覽器會(huì)話的期間,只要關(guān)閉瀏覽器,cookie就消失了。如果設(shè)置了cokie的過(guò)期時(shí)間.那么瀏覽器會(huì)...
...保存路徑中找對(duì)應(yīng)的文件。 找到文件之后,檢驗(yàn)是否在有效期內(nèi),在有效期內(nèi)就讀取文件,不再有效期內(nèi)就清空文件 2、自己實(shí)現(xiàn)session需要考慮的幾個(gè)問(wèn)題 1)、生成唯一值的算法 2)、將session存到文件里還是存到redis還是memcache,...
...改其中的SESSION_DRIVER選項(xiàng)。 lifetime配置項(xiàng)用于設(shè)置Session有效期,默認(rèn)為120分鐘。expire_on_close配置項(xiàng)用于設(shè)置是否在瀏覽器關(guān)閉時(shí)立即讓Session失效。encrypt配置項(xiàng)用于配置Session數(shù)據(jù)是否加密。lottery配置項(xiàng)用于配置回收Session存放位...
...放在服務(wù)器上,Session里任何隱私都能夠有效的保護(hù)。 3、有效期上的不同 使用過(guò)Google的人都曉得,假如登錄過(guò)Google,則Google的登錄信息長(zhǎng)期有效。用戶不用每次訪問(wèn)都重新登錄,Google會(huì)持久地記載該用戶的登錄信息。要到達(dá)這...
...信的session_key 是獨(dú)立的。而且業(yè)務(wù)自身的session也有設(shè)置有效期,和微信的session_key 是一致的。 我們的業(yè)務(wù)處理流程是: 1、前端檢測(cè)有無(wú)session,沒(méi)有的話wx.login(),獲取session_key 。2、通過(guò)session_key 調(diào)用后臺(tái)接口,換取session。3、...
...流程,我們來(lái)捋下邏輯。 1、用戶使用wx.login獲取臨時(shí)code,有效期為5分鐘 2、將臨時(shí)code傳到我們自己的后端服務(wù),調(diào)用微信的API獲取用戶的session_key和openid 3、后端自定義新的密鑰并關(guān)聯(lián)返回的session_key和openid,將新的密鑰返給前...
...參數(shù),有興趣的可查手冊(cè)) setcookie(數(shù)據(jù)名,數(shù)據(jù)值,有效期,有效路徑,有效域名); // 特例: // PHP_INT_MAX 永久有效 // / 默認(rèn)是當(dāng)前目錄及子目錄有效,我這里改成了整站有效 // .6758591.com 默認(rèn)是當(dāng)...
...規(guī)范,1表示遵循W3C的RFC 2109規(guī)范 1.1.7 Cookie的有效期 Cookie的maxAge決定著Cookie的有效期,單位為秒(Second)。Cookie中通過(guò)getMaxAge()方法與setMaxAge(int maxAge)方法來(lái)讀寫(xiě)maxAge屬性。 如果maxAge屬性為正數(shù),則表示該Cookie會(huì)在ma...
...口更新服務(wù)器存儲(chǔ)的 session_key。2.微信不會(huì)把 session_key 的有效期告知開(kāi)發(fā)者。我們會(huì)根據(jù)用戶使用小程序的行為對(duì) session_key 進(jìn)行續(xù)期。用戶越頻繁使用小程序,session_key 有效期越長(zhǎng)。3.開(kāi)發(fā)者在 session_key 失效時(shí),可以通過(guò)重新...
...用戶再次訪問(wèn)web應(yīng)用,會(huì)帶上identity cookie(因?yàn)樵揷ookie的有效期較長(zhǎng))。web應(yīng)用首先判斷用戶為未登錄狀態(tài)(因?yàn)閟ession失效了)。 web應(yīng)用嘗試通過(guò)identity cookie為用戶自動(dòng)登錄。應(yīng)用從identity cookie中獲取用戶id和用戶au...
ChatGPT和Sora等AI大模型應(yīng)用,將AI大模型和算力需求的熱度不斷帶上新的臺(tái)階。哪里可以獲得...
營(yíng)銷(xiāo)賬號(hào)總被封?TK直播頻繁掉線?雙ISP靜態(tài)住宅IP+輕量云主機(jī)打包套餐來(lái)襲,確保開(kāi)出來(lái)的云主機(jī)不...
大模型的訓(xùn)練用4090是不合適的,但推理(inference/serving)用4090不能說(shuō)合適,...